Claims (1)
- 양극을 포함하는 양극실과 음극을 포함하는 음극실, 이들을 분리하는 양이온교환막으로 구성되는 전기화학적 단위셀을 연속 설치하여 대량의 폐수를 처리하며, 양극실에서는 고농도 유기화합물의 산화반응을 유도하여 완전 분해하며, 음극실에서는 환원이 필요한 폐수를 환원하여 무해한 가스로 전환하는 전기화학 시스템
